From 94efbe19b9f121e68625ac0edf0317075acc302e Mon Sep 17 00:00:00 2001 From: Qu Wenruo Date: Fri, 1 Apr 2022 19:23:18 +0800 Subject: [PATCH] btrfs: raid56: introduce new cached members for btrfs_raid_bio The new members are all related to number of sectors, but the existing number of pages members are kept as is: - nr_sectors Total sectors of the full stripe including P/Q. - stripe_nsectors The sectors of a single stripe.
